Option 1 Option 2 Option 3 php artisan make:livewire contact-form. Notice that we are no longer calling the setMessageToHello function, we are directly specifying, what we want data set to. You can directly use any valid key names exposed via KeyboardEvent.key as modifiers by converting them to kebab-case. You are going to understand how to use this package to create a dynamic multi-step form with a laravel form wizard. How to use radio button to make modal open? - Livewire Forum The text was updated successfully, but these errors were encountered: @phamhuutruong7 I'm not exactly clear on the problem. Already on GitHub? How To Get Current DATE, Week Data in MySQL This tutorial will guide you from scratch about how to create a multi-step way not only but also form a wizard with the help of the livewire package in the laravel application. 2 . I'm Squishy, the friendly jellyfish that manages Livewire issues. Building The Frontend w/ Tailwind UI 10:16. Have a question about this project? [emailprotected]. Laravel Livewire Form Example - ItSolutionStuff.com However, if you would like to use them, you should publish them using the Artisan vendor:publish command: You may gain . The Laravel Livewire provides 6 types of Life Cycle Hook methods so that developer can make use of these methods for various reason such as control DOM update when the value of property changes, Show a message to the client when some lengthy task is being performed, set or unset . There are multiple ways to fire events from Livewire components. Livewire | Laravel Jetstream On what basis are pardoning decisions made by presidents or governors when exercising their pardoning power?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Well occasionally send you account related emails. For example: This feature is actually incredibly powerful. Did you check that $brands object is not empty? As long as two Livewire components are living on the same page, they can communicate using events and listeners. (which returns true in php), so it has 2 checked in radio. $type bound itself to the selected radio option fine, and the output value matched. how to change phpmyadmin login url ubuntu 20.04 to your account. Strap on your snorkel, we're diving in. After selecting the range, click Insert then select Checkbox . The <input type="radio"> defines a radio button. How to Fetch Data From MongoDB in Node js And Display in HTML EJS Internally, Livewire listens for "input" events on the element and updates the class property with the element's value. Login. Can you setup a https://laravelplayground.com/ to demonstrate the issue? Sign in Or is this the only thing that has been tried so far? |-------------------------------------------------------------------------- When the above form is submitted with a radio button selected, the form's data includes an entry in the form contact=value.For example, if the user clicks on the "Phone" radio button then submits the form, the form's data will include the line contact=phone.. Or is this the only thing that has been tried . Eventually, the Laravel Livewire Wizard Form tutorial is over, i hope now you have clear understanding of how to build multi step form in Laravel application with Livewire Wizard package. Could a subterranean river or aquifer generate enough continuous momentum to power a waterwheel for the purpose of producing electricity? Checked on input radio - Help - Livewire Forum In V2 you can wire:model bind directly to eloquent model properties. We and our partners use data for Personalised ads and content, ad and content measurement, audience insights and product development. A bit dirty, but simply add manually the active class when needed : @ambitionphp A bit dirty, but simply add manually the active class when needed : You signed in with another tab or window. Don't use checked on radio buttons as Livewire will take care of everything. (Like often in the case of registering a listener on a modal backdrop). Laravel livewire form radio - laracasts.com Livewire is a full-stack framework for Laravel that makes building dynamic interfaces simple, without leaving the comfort of Laravel. When the user types something into the text field, the value of the $name property will automatically update. Wire:model can't bind any of them, so it would not be "checked". | However, we are trying out the new Github Discussions. (More info on this philosophy here: https://twitter.com/calebporzio/status/1321864801295978497), checked property is not working for radio button in livewire when browser load or update time. Laravel 8 Livewire Form Example Tutorial - Lara Tutorials Model binding with Radio button Issue #2705 livewire/livewire I think the issue is with this here wire:model="brandsVal" The issue with the current implementation is that all of the radio buttons have the same name attribute "brandsVal" and the same wire:model value "brandsVal", so when one of the buttons is selected, all of the buttons will have the same value. Would you ever say "eat pig" instead of "eat pork"? Required fields are marked *. Why in the Sierpiski Triangle is this set being used as the example for the OSC and not a more "natural"? If the name of the event and the method you're calling match, you can leave out the key. migrate:refresh specific table laravel. Describe the bug I am using bootstrap v4 and I want to have radio button, But it wont work. If your action requires any services that should be resolved via Laravel's dependency injection container, you can list them in the action's signature before any additional parameters: Like you saw in the keydown example, Livewire directives sometimes offer "modifiers" to add extra functionality to an event. Then add the following code into it: Finally, open your command prompt again and run the following command to start development server for your simple laravel 8 livewire form example app: In step 9, open your browser and fire the following url into your browser: My name is Yogi and i am a full-stack developer, entrepreneur, and owner of laratutorials.com. I love to write on JavaScript, ECMAScript, React, Angular, Vue, Laravel. * Reverse the migrations. <!-- Antlers --> {{ livewire:form handle="contact" }} <!-- Inertia Because the database set this column to boolean so it gonna be like this. Will re-render the component without firing any action, Shortcut to update the value of a property, Shortcut to toggle boolean properties on or off, Will emit an event on the global event bus, with the provided params. How to Get & Set Data Attribute Values Of Input, Select box jQuery If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. We are hoping that this will encourage and centeralize feedback relating to discussions like this. This quick and simple tutorial offers you a facile example of a multi-step using bootstrap wizard UI design in laravel app with livewire library. This is one of the many ways to bridge the gap between PHP and JavaScript with Livewire. When we created the Jetstream Livewire stack, a variety of Blade components (buttons, panels, inputs, modals) were created to assist in creating UI consistency and ease of use. */, "{{ str_replace('_', '-', app()->getLocale()) }}", "//maxcdn.bootstrapcdn.com/bootstrap/4.5.0/css/bootstrap.min.css", "//cdnjs.cloudflare.com/ajax/libs/jquery/3.2.1/jquery.min.js", "//maxcdn.bootstrapcdn.com/bootstrap/4.1.1/js/bootstrap.min.js", Laravel 9 jQuery Show Hide Div with Radio Button Tutorial, How to Seed US States in Database using Laravel 9 Seeder, Laravel 9 Bootstrap Add Product to Shopping Cart Tutorial, How to Run Specific Seeder To Insert Records in Laravel 9, Laravel 9 Input Empty Space or White Space Validation Tutorial, How to Integrate Botman Chatbot Widget in Laravel 9 App, How to Build Dependent Dropdown with Laravel 9 Livewire, How to Show Notification using Sweet Alert in Laravel 9, How to Validate Form Input Field using Alpha Rule in Laravel 9, How to Delete Multiple Data using Checkbox in Laravel 9, How to Set, Get and Delete Cookies in Laravel 9 App, How to Send PDF Attachment using Email in Laravel 9, 2016-2021 All Rights Reserved - www.positronx.io. In this example post, i will install livewire package and create livewire form components using livewire artisan commands in laravel 8. Format The Sheet And Add Checkboxes. The best way to understand it is to just look at the code. We and our partners use cookies to Store and/or access information on a device. Step 7 - Create Blade Views. Save my name, email, and website in this browser for the next time I comment. How to Get DAY Name OF Given Date In MySQL It's not them. 3 Methods to Remove Duplicates From Array In JavaScript Of course, the property should be set to false when you are ready to close the modal. I am using bootstrap v4 and I want to have radio button, But it wont work. Livewire is a full-stack framework for Laravel framework that makes building dynamic interfaces simple, without leaving the comfort of Laravel. First Day Of Current Month in MySQL The issue with the current implementation is that all of the radio buttons have the same name attribute "brandsVal" and the same wire:model value "brandsVal", so when one of the buttons is selected, all of the buttons will have the same value. We will discuss each of these features below. Thanks for contributing an answer to Stack Overflow! Build Laravel 9 Livewire CRUD Application using JetStream - positronX.io Well occasionally send you account related emails. To style checkboxes, use a wrapper element with class="form-check" to ensure proper margins for labels and checkboxes. How to Add Google Sheets Radio Buttons (2023 Update) https://laravel-livewire.com/docs/2.x/troubleshooting#root-element-issues. You should see "Hello World!". I am Digamber, a full-stack developer and fitness aficionado. By default, Livewire applies a 150ms debounce to text inputs. Install PHP in Ubuntu from Scratch Also, is other Livewire functionality working for this component / on this page? So, you will learn step by step how to create livewire form and submit livewire form in laravel 8. Step 9: Start Development Server. If the previously selected radio button is not de-selecting, it suggests you haven't grouped your radio button elements correctly using thename attribute.. If you're familiar with Laravel, you can think of Livewire components like Blade includes, allowing you to insert @livewire anywhere in a Blade view to render the component. I'm trying to find a way to bind it with the null. Use the checked attribute if you want the checkbox to be checked by default. In step 1, open your terminal and navigate to your local web server directory using the following command: Then install laravel 8 latest application using the following command: In step 2, open your downloaded laravel 8 app into any text editor. How about saving the world? So, you will learn step by step how to create livewire form and submit livewire form in laravel 8. get selected value of dropdown in jquery on button click Here are some common events you may need to listen for: You can pass extra parameters into a Livewire action directly in the expression like so: Extra parameters passed to an action, will be passed through to the component's method as standard PHP params: Action parameters are also capable of directly resolving a model by its key using a type hint. Laravel Livewire is a library that makes it simple to build modern, reactive, dynamic interfaces using Laravel Blade as your templating language. Step 8 - Start Development Server. Laravel livewire is a user-friendly package for developing full-stack web applications; it lowers the pain of building dynamic user interface components.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Livewire Forms - a Statamic Addon Then find .env file and configure database detail like following: In step 3, open command prompt and navigate to your project by using the following command: Then create model and migration file by using the following command: The above command will create two files into your laravel 8 livewire form example application, which is located inside the following locations: Now, find Conatct.php model file inside Laravel8LivewireForm/app/Models directory. I like to writing and sharing tutorials of PHP, Python, Javascript, JQuery, Laravel, Livewire, Codeigniter, Node JS, Express JS, Vue JS, Angular JS, React Js, MySQL, MongoDB, REST APIs, Windows, Xampp, Linux, Ubuntu, Amazon AWS, Composer, SEO, WordPress, SSL, Bootstrap. Laravel 8 livewire form example. livewire radio button example - workflowoptimization.us Below are the available modifiers that can be used with any event. Checkboxes are used if you want the user to select any number of options from a list of preset options. 1. Step 4: Create Component. First, format the sheet and add checkboxes in the process. Ajax POST By jQuery Api density matrix. Examples might be simplified to improve reading and learning. . Below are the available modifiers that can be used with any event. In RadioButton, you are allowed to display text, image, or both and when you select one radio button in a group . Livewire components can communicate with each other through a global event system. @haruk1515 Yes it's not
the problem is with, This is your issue. Ajax $.GET By jQuery Api Consider my interest piqued. Radio In Button Groups Not Work (Can not select radio with label without page refresh laravel . https://twitter.com/calebporzio/status/1321864801295978497. Now they created fies on both path: path. Step 6: Frame Up CRUD Component. I've just tested your code locally and it works fine for me. * In addition, Jetstream includes two types of modals: dialog-modal and confirmation-modal. In the second picture, wire:model is compared null == 0. Thank you for subscribing; please check your inbox to confirm your subscription. Note: The radio group must have share the same name (the value of the name attribute) to be treated as a group. try this instead, Now generate the input elements in your blade file like this. Demo jQuery Wrap(Elements) & Unwrap(Elements) Hey, please post your Livewire component class so we can check that over as well. To make a basic form with radio buttons in it, wrap your radio button grouping(s) in a <form> tag, and include a <button> of type submit at the bottom. How to Convert Comma Separated String into an Array in JavaScript? Now, the $name property will only be updated when the user clicks away from the input field. RadioButton in C# - GeeksforGeeks Events | Laravel Livewire You are free to use or not use these components. You are free to use or not use these components. Throughout this Laravel tutorial, you will learn how to create a multi-step form in the Laravel application using Laravel form wizard using Livewire package. What seems to be the problem: Hi, is there a solution on how to use the radio button to make the modal open? Step 6 - Build Livewire Components. Why did DOS-based Windows require HIMEM.SYS to boot? And open it then add the fillable property code into Contact.php file, like following: Then, find create_contacts_table.php file inside Laravel8LivewireForm/database/migrations/ directory. Sometimes you may only want to emit an event on the component that fired the event. The following example will look for a App\Http\Livewire\ContactForm.php component. Some of our partners may process your data as a part of their legitimate business interest without asking for consent. Different Types of Joins In MySQL with Examples HTML input type="radio" - W3School The consent submitted will only be used for data processing originating from this website. The property's name should correspond to a boolean property on your Livewire component's corresponding PHP class. In this example post, i will install livewire package and create livewire form components using livewire artisan commands in laravel 8. Here is a quick list of some common ones you may need: In the above example, the handler will only be called if event.key is equal to 'PageDown'. When using Livewire, your application's routes will respond with typical Blade templates.
Erin Brockovich Jorge Halaby,
Venus Ascendant Line Astrocartography,
Articles L